como executar o programa usando a biblioteca png

0

Eu instalei a libpng e zlib e quero rodar este programa usando png.h . Eu tenho Code :: Blocks e sou completamente novo em TI. Eu não sei porque não funciona. Eu recebo o seguinte:

undefined reference to png_create_write_struct.

Devo também fazer algo para adicionar bibliotecas no menu Code :: Blocks?

    
por user6056445 13.03.2016 / 13:07

1 resposta

1

Você também precisa instalar os pacotes -dev se fizer o desenvolvimento de software (o que você já fez, se você executou o comando a partir do seu link).

libpng12-0:
This package contains the runtime library files needed to run software using libpng.

libpng12-dev
This package contains the header and development files needed to build programs and packages using libpng.

Além disso, em Code :: Blocks, clique com o botão direito do mouse no projectname na árvore de projetos e selecione "Build options ...". Na próxima janela, selecione o topo da árvore no lado esquerdo (você nome do projeto). Na parte principal da janela, selecione "Configurações do vinculador". Na caixa de listagem à esquerda, adicione uma entrada com o nome

libpng

Agora seu projeto deve ser compilado corretamente.

    
por cmks 13.03.2016 / 13:21